How to make carrot jam
Prepare ingredients
- Carrots: 1kg
- White granulated sugar: 600g
- Vanilla powder
- 1 small piece of lime (or lime powder): about 30g
How to make carrot jam
Preparing carrots
First, mix lime with about 2 liters of water and wait until the lime is completely dissolved and the lime residue settles to the bottom. Then, gently pour the top lime water into a basin.
Next, wash carrots, peel and cut into pieces about 0.5cm thick. If you want, you can carve flowers for the carrots to look better.

Place all carrots in the prepared lime water and soak for 1-2 hours. After that, take the carrots out and wash several times with clean water to remove lime and residues..
Marinating and stir-frying carrots
Arrange a layer of carrots in a pot and add sugar. Repeat this process until all ingredients are used, and marinate until the sugar is completely dissolved.
Place the pot of carrots on the stove and cook over medium-high heat. Occasionally, stir well so that the carrots are evenly coated with sugar.

When the sugar syrup is almost dry, lower the heat to the lowest setting and continue to stir until you see the sugar crystallize into a fine white powder coating the carrot pieces. Then, add a few drops of vanilla, stir quickly and turn off the heat. Remove the pot from the stove.
Continue stirring for about 1-2 more minutes to finish the jam-making process. Wait until the jam is completely dry and cool before packing into zip bags or sealed containers.

How to make carrot jam without using alum
Prepare ingredients
- Carrots: 300g
- Sugar: 150g
- Rice washing water
- 1 tube of vanilla
How to make carrot jam without using alum
Preparing carrots
After washing the carrots, cut them into slices before grating to make it easier. Next, grate the carrots into thin, long strips that are easy to eat.

Then, soak the grated carrots in the prepared rice washing water for about 6 hours. After soaking, wash the carrots with clean water to remove other impurities.
Boiling carrots
Next, boil water until it bubbles, then add the prepared carrots to the boiling water and boil for about 2 minutes. Boiling carrots for this short time helps them become softer but still retain their natural crispness.
After that, put the boiled carrots in cold ice water to cool them down quickly and keep the carrots crispy.
Marinating with sugar
Next, add 150g of sugar to the grated carrots and stir well to ensure the sugar is evenly distributed. Then, marinate the carrots with sugar for about 4 hours so that the sugar dissolves completely and penetrates into the carrots.
Stir-frying jam
Next, pour the sugar syrup into a pan that has been heated over medium-high heat. When the sugar boils, lower the heat to medium and add the carrots to the pan, then stir evenly so that the carrots are evenly covered by the sugar syrup.

When the sugar syrup has thickened, lower the heat to the lowest setting and add the vanilla tube to create a fragrant scent for the carrot jam. Next, stir quickly so that the jam can dry quickly.
Continue stir-frying for about 5 minutes until the sugar syrup is completely dry and forms a fine powdered sugar layer coating the carrots. After that, turn off the heat and continue to stir for about 5 more minutes to let the carrot jam dry completely.
